Cannabis and cognitive functioning in multiple sclerosis: The role of gender
Bibliographic record
Abstract
Background Cognitive function in people with multiple sclerosis (PwMS) is associated with gender differences and the use of smoked/ingested cannabis. Objective The objective of this report is to explore a possible gender-cannabis interaction associated with cognitive dysfunction in PwMS. Methods A retrospective analysis was undertaken of cognitive data collected from 140 PwMS. A general linear model was conducted to determine gender and cannabis effects on processing speed (SDMT), verbal (CVLT-II) and visual (BVMT-R) memory, and executive functions (D-KEFS), while controlling for age and years of education. Results Cannabis was smoked at least once a month by 33 (23.6%) participants. Cannabis users were more impaired on the SDMT ( p = 0.044). Men, who comprised 30.7% of the entire sample and 42.2% of cannabis users, were more impaired on the CVLT-II (total learning, p = 0.001; delayed recall, p = 0.004). A cannabis-gender interaction was found with the CVLT-II delayed recall ( p = 0.049) and BVMT-R total learning ( p = 0.014), where male cannabis users performed more poorly than female. Conclusion Males with MS may be particularly vulnerable to the cognitive side effects of smoked cannabis use.
